GLP-1, or glucagon-like peptide-1, is a hormone produced naturally in the body in response to food intake. It plays a crucial role in balancing blood sugar levels, stimulating insulin release when needed, and slowing gastric emptying. Natural alternatives to GLP-1 testing in Auburn can include dietary and lifestyle interventions. A balanced diet rich in fiber, lean proteins, and whole foods supports healthy blood sugar levels and gut health, which is closely linked to insulin sensitivity. Regular physical activity also plays a significant role, as it enhances muscle glucose uptake and improves insulin action. These approaches not only promote better GLP-1 production but also have numerous other health benefits.
